Loop Quantum Gravity Modification of the Compton Effect
Modified dispersion relations(MDRs) as a manifestation of Lorentz invariance
violation, have been appeared in alternative approaches to quantum gravity
problem. Loop quantum gravity is one of these approaches which evidently
requires modification of dispersion relations. These MDRs will affect the usual
formulation of the Compton effect. The purpose of this paper is to incorporate
the effects of loop quantum gravity MDRs on the formulation of Compton
scattering. Using limitations imposed on MDRs parameters from Ultra High Energy
Cosmic Rays(UHECR), we estimate the quantum gravity-induced wavelength shift of
scattered photons in a typical Compton process. Possible experimental detection
of this wavelength shift will provide strong support for underlying quantum
